History: As the Double-A affiliate for the New York Giants, the ‘51 Millers began the season with a star young centerfielder named Willie Mays (#8). In only 35 games, Mays became so popular in Minneapolis that when the Giants called him up to the Major Leagues, the club took out ads in the local Minneapolis newspaper apologizing to local fans for taking away their young phenom, who would go on to win the 1951 National League Rookie of the Year.
